Constraints

What shapes the shoot

  • Tide dictates the aerial window; low water and high water read completely differently.
  • Aerial permissions coordinate with port authority and coastguard.
  • Salt and spray require rig protection; every visit carries wet-weather covers.

FAQs

Questions we hear

How is drone weather handled over water?

Wind and precipitation limits are strict over water — flights are grounded well before nominal limits.

Does the shoot get rescheduled if the tide is wrong?

Yes — the tide window is booked before the diary window; a wrong tide is a reschedule.

Is a drone roof inspection in Wirral cheaper than scaffolding?

For a typical Wirral roof, drone inspection comes in well under the cost of even a single day's tower scaffold.

Can the report be used for an insurance claim?

Yes — the Wirral report is supplied as a date-stamped PDF accepted by major UK insurers.

What if the weather changes on the day?

Flights inside Wirral are rescheduled at no charge if sustained wind exceeds 24 mph or rain is forecast.
